Obituary Writing 101: Examples and Best Practices

Writing an obituary can feel like a daunting task, especially during a time of grief. Nevertheless, it's important to remember that this piece functions as a lasting tribute to the life of your loved one. A well-crafted obituary not only shares essential facts but also captures their spirit and celebrates their influence on the world.

  • Launch with the basics: full name, date of birth, date of death, and place of residence.
  • Highlight key achievements in their life, such as education, career highlights, and hobbies.
  • Express anecdotes that illustrate their character and the laughter they brought to others.
  • Summarize with information about family members.

Keep in mind that an obituary is a chance to honor your loved one's life in a meaningful way. Be genuine, be concise, and let their story shine.

Remembering Lives: Exploring Different Types of Obituary Examples

When a dear friend passes away, it's natural to want to remember their impact. An obituary is often the initial gesture in this process, providing a lasting tribute to a person's life story. There are different types of obituaries, each with its own distinct approach.

Some obituaries emphasize factual information about the deceased's accomplishments, including their birth date, death date, and career highlights. Others take a more personal tone, offering glimpses into the person's personality and impact on others. Creative obituaries are also becoming increasingly popular, allowing families to share unique details.

Ultimately, the best type of obituary is the one that captures the essence the person who has passed away. It should be a tribute of their special place in our hearts.
